SEA energy, natural resource key sectors for SocGen

Bank will expand its project, infrastructure financing business

Published Sun, Sep 28, 2014 · 04:00 PM
Share this article.

[SINGAPORE] Societe Generale corporate and investment banking (CIB) will focus on its core strengths in the energy and natural resource sectors to expand in South-east Asia, says a senior executive.

Over the next three years, the French bank is ready to deploy capital to expand its project and infrastructure financing businesses, said Didier Valet, Societe Generale global head, CIB, private banking, asset management and securities division.

It will also be able to fully tap its latest acquisition, Newedge - one of the world's largest derivatives brokerages - to offer customers brokerage and clearing services.
